Проект XCode - макрос для уникальных адресов серверов для каждого разработчика - PullRequest
0 голосов
/ 23 марта 2011

Когда я разрабатываю приложение для iPhone, которое взаимодействует с приложением Rails, работающим на моем ноутбуке, я сделаю что-то вроде

    model.serverIp = @"192.168.0.23";

Я совершу это, и следующий парень это проверит,и изменяет его на свой IP-адрес, а затем фиксирует, а затем я должен изменить его ........

Каков наилучший способ избежать наступления друг на друга здесь?

1 Ответ

1 голос
/ 23 марта 2011

В целях разработки может быть достаточно одной из следующих вещей:

  • Укажите внешний файл, который не отмечен, который содержит соответствующий IP-адрес и добавлен в качестве файла ресурсов в приложение iPhone.
  • Добавить код в приложение, чтобы оно могло автоматически распознавать IP-адрес
  • Использовать адрес обратной связи (при условии, что тестовый сервер всегда работает на той же машине, что и приложение для iPhone)
  • Развертывание общего сервера с фиксированным IP-адресом для использования всеми пользователями
...